Scientific Name | Desmopuntius hexazona (Weber & de Beaufort, 1912) |
Common Names | Six Banded Barb Fembandsbarb, Five Banded Barb |
Type Locality | Tuluk and Gunung Sahilan, Sumatra, Indonesia. |
Species Information | |
Size | 55mm or 2.2" SL. Find near, nearer or same sized spp. |
Sexing | Typically, males have brighter colour, in particular a brighter red colouration. |
Habitat Information | |
Distribution | Asia: Peninsular Malaysia, Indonesia (Sumatra) and Borneo. Found in the Mekong basin.
